Q:

Choose the missing terms out of the given alternatives Z, X, S, I, R, R, ?, ?

A) J, I B) K, M
C) G, I D) J, K
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: C) G, I

Explanation:

Z - 2 = X
X - 5 = S
S - 10 = I
I - 17 = R
R - 26 = R
R - 37 = G
G - 50 = I
The series 2, 5, 10, 17, 26, 37, 50 is obtained by the pattern +3, +5, +7, +9, . . . .
